The 1950s and 60s are often referred to as the Golden Era of Bollywood. This period saw the rise of iconic filmmakers like Raj Kapoor, Guru Dutt, and B.R. Chopra, who produced films that are still considered classics today. Movies like "Shree 420" (1955), "Pyaasa" (1957), and "Mughal-e-Azam" (1960) showcased exceptional storytelling, music, and dance. These films not only entertained but also addressed social issues, earning the industry a reputation for producing meaningful cinema. hindmoviez co hot
